What is Medical Billing and Coding?
Before we dive into the online school scene, let's make sure we're on the same page about what medical billing and coding actually entails. In simple terms, these are the professionals who ensure that hospitals, clinics, and other healthcare providers get paid for the services they provide.
* Medical Billers are responsible for submitting claims to insurance companies, following up on denied claims, and ensuring that payments are received and posted accurately.
* Medical Coders assign standard codes to diagnoses and procedures, making it possible for insurance companies to understand and process claims.

Accreditation
First and foremost, it's crucial to ensure that the program you choose is accredited by a recognized organization, such as the Commission on Accreditation for Health Informatics and Information Management Education (CAHIIM) or the American Academy of Professional Coders (AAPC). Accreditation ensures that the program meets specific quality standards and will prepare you for certification exams and future employment.
Curriculum
Take a close look at the curriculum to ensure it covers all the essential topics, such as medical terminology, anatomy and physiology, healthcare reimbursement methods, and coding systems like ICD-10 and CPT. Also, check if the program offers any specializations, like outpatient coding or revenue cycle management, to help you tailor your education to your career goals.
Externship and Clinical Rotation Opportunities
While many aspects of medical billing and coding can be learned online, there's no substitute for hands-on experience. Look for programs that offer externships or clinical rotations, allowing you to apply your knowledge in a real-world setting and make valuable connections in the industry.

Certification: The Key to Unlocking Your Career Potential
While not always required, obtaining certification can significantly enhance your employability and earning potential. The two main organizations offering certification exams are the American Academy of Professional Coders (AAPC) and the American Health Information Management Association (AHIMA).
AAPC offers the Certified Professional Biller (CPB) and Certified Professional Coder (CPC) credentials, which focus more on the coding aspect of the profession. AHIMA offers the Registered Health Information Technician (RHIT) and Registered Health Information Administrator (RHIA) credentials, which provide a broader education in health information management.
Choosing the right certification path depends on your career goals and the specific requirements of the jobs you're interested in. Many online school medical billing and coding programs prepare you for one or both of these certification exams, so be sure to check which ones are covered in the curriculum.
Career Outlook and Salary Potential
Now that you know what to expect from an online school medical billing and coding program, let's talk about the exciting career opportunities that await you!
According to the U.S. Bureau of Labor Statistics, employment of medical billers and coders is projected to grow 8% from 2019 to 2029, much faster than the average for all occupations. This growth is driven by the aging population, which will require more medical services, and the increased use of electronic health records, which requires more professionals to manage and organize them.
As for the salary potential, the median annual wage for medical billers and coders was $42,630 in May 2020. Keep in mind that salaries can vary depending on factors such as your level of experience, the specific industry you work in, and your geographic location.
